Tongue Tangle Song Lyrics

Sung to the tune of "Potatoes"

Return to Beginning Sounds Lesson Plan

1. Peter Piper picked a peck of
Prickly pickled peppers.
Better Botter bought some better buns
And bitter butter.
Words that start the same are fun
To sing and say them quick,
So better get your tongue in shape
Or it will surely stick!


4. Suzy Smith was sitting still and
Suddenly saw a spider.
Fearless Freddy fanned the flames and
Found his foot on fire.
Words that start the same are fun
To sing and say them quick,
So better get your tongue in shape
Or it will surely stick!


2. Cathy Casey cracked a couple of
Cups of creamy coffee.
Terry Topper tipped a ton of
Tangled twisted toffee.
Words that start the same are fun
To sing and say them quick,
So better get your tongue in shape
Or it will surely stick!


5. Mandy Monk made many messy
Mounds of muddy marbles.
Greta Gobbler gabbed and gabbed
And gradually grew garbled.
Words that start the same are fun
To sing and say them quick,
So better get your tongue in shape
Or it will surely stick!


3. Danny Drake has dirty dogs
And doesn't do the dishes.
Wendy Ward was washing wool
In wells that were for wishes.
Words that start the same are fun
To sing and say them quick,
So better get your tongue in shape
Or it will surely stick!
